What Does “Free Visa” Mean?

A “free visa” typically refers to the ability to enter a country without the need to apply for a visa beforehand. This can take several forms:

  1. Visa-Free Entry – You don’t need a visa at all for a set period (e.g., 30 or 90 days).
  2. Visa on Arrival (VOA) – You obtain a visa when you land at the airport or enter through borders.
  3. Electronic Travel Authorization (eTA) – A simplified online approval, often free or low-cost.

These arrangements depend on bilateral agreements between countries and are often based on diplomatic, security, and economic considerations.

Things to Keep in Mind

Even if a country offers visa-free entry, travelers should still:

  • Check passport validity – Most countries require at least six months’ validity.
  • Confirm duration of stay – Overstaying can lead to fines or bans.
  • Know entry restrictions – Some visa-free countries may impose conditions based on recent travel or security issues.
